Transaction fda86ed96d70dfba63bfdc858b278ef898ab873575b1e5d28142a4b7321572c4

1 Input
2 Outputs
  • fda86ed96d70dfba63bfdc858b278ef898ab873575b1e5d28142a4b7321572c4:0
  • value  780190811
    address  38v6keKDpPNsUeeJioYrfkhiBjoyQBYCf5
  • fda86ed96d70dfba63bfdc858b278ef898ab873575b1e5d28142a4b7321572c4:1
  • value  1839817
    address  12NQrNS8qpsnaEgkRcqTRhm5T8eSXXZHZb